Sports Authority Corporate Offices Evacuated

ENGLEWOOD, Colo. (CBS4)- Employees at the Sports Authority Corporate Headquarters in Englewood were evacuated from the building on Monday afternoon because of a threat.

Englewood Police spokesman Brian Cousineau said a bomb threat was called into the office building located at 1050 W. Hampden Ave. just before 4 p.m.

Everyone was evacuated and several surrounding roads to the building were blocked off by police but it did not disrupt the evening commute on Hampden Ave.

Bomb squads searched the building.

Copter4 flew over the headquarters and found several dozen people standing in the parking lot which was blocked off by police cruisers.

Police did not know the motivation behind the threat.
